medieval
/mษชd.หiห.vษl/noun
- 1
Someone living in the Middle Ages.
- 2
A medieval example (of something aforementioned or understood from context).
โThank God for modern remedies: the medievals were often useless or even harmful.โ
adjective
- 1
Of or relating to the Middle Ages, the period from approximately 500 to 1500 AD.
- 2
Having characteristics associated with the Middle Ages in popular, modern cultural perception:
